Reef Campground is a very popular campground with people in Hereford. Summertime highs at Reef Campground commonly tend to be in the 90's. During the moonlight hours it's usually in the 60's. The winter brings highs down to the 50's while Reef | |
|
Campground night low temperatures through the wintertime are in the 20's. The wonderful local attractions and the nearby outdoors recreation will make you glad you came. There's such a great deal of things to do in close proximity to Reef Campground, and it is a fun site for
the whole family. It is very waterless here at Reef Campground typically; July is the wettest month with most rain, and May is when it's the driest.
